California Penal Code Section 300.1

CA Penal Code § 300.1 (2017)  

(a) Nothing in this chapter shall be construed to restrict the authority of local law enforcement to maintain their own DNA-related databases or data banks, or to restrict the Department of Justice with respect to data banks and databases created by other statutory authority, including, but not limited to, databases related to fingerprints, firearms and other weapons, child abuse, domestic violence deaths, child deaths, driving offenses, missing persons, violent crime information as described in Title 12 (commencing with Section 14200) of Part 4, and criminal justice statistics permitted by Section 13305.

(b) Nothing in this chapter shall be construed to limit the authority of local or county coroners or their agents, in the course of their scientific investigation, to utilize genetic and DNA technology to inquire into and determine the circumstances, manner, and cause of death, or to employ or use outside laboratories, hospitals, or research institutions that utilize genetic and DNA technology.

(Amended November 2, 2004, by initiative Proposition 69, Sec. 13.)
